Ryan Reaves has signed a new contract with the New York Rangers.
35+ Contract (Extension)
Comparable ContractsCOMPARE THIS CONTRACT
SIGNED BY: Chris Drury
Length: 1 year
Value: $1,750,000
Expiry Status: UFA
Cap % Tooltip: 2.15
Signing Team: Logo of the New York RangersNew York Rangers
Signing Date: Jul. 31, 2021
Source: CapFriendly

Ryan Reaves signed a 1 year, $1,750,000 contract with the New York Rangers on Jul. 31, 2021. The contract has a cap hit of $1,750,000.
